Output 136380a5d064ad83d27ef3e1f5216c51c71201b68e74f154e8f1b9f5d08669d7:265

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 907e6895550f5a120d2fcf681d6b33f7b567b57a0c596c68d702d4261fae268c
address
tb1pjplx3924padpyrf0ea5p66en776k0dt6p3vkc6xhqt2zv8awy6xq6dwp6v
transaction
136380a5d064ad83d27ef3e1f5216c51c71201b68e74f154e8f1b9f5d08669d7